Hong, her name was Hong. This name wasn't as interesting as the person herself. Chu Beijie had just gained another common maid but he felt much more excited than usual for some reason. It was like he'd come across a 'once-in-a-lifetime' preciousness, or a deliciously exotic cuisine and couldn't wait to taste it, but at the same time, couldn't bear to ruin it.

The new maid, Hong, had lied to the Duke of Zhen-Bei, had been caught by him and was now locked in a small room of his Ducal Residence, away from everyone else.

Chu Beijie wanted to see her, but for some reason he kept on stopping himself.

He wasn't a god, so of course he was angry. Several times he had woken up in the middle of the night, grinding his teeth and fists clenched, thinking that he, a Duke, got all messed up by a maid and ended up standing in front of another woman's door. His pride as a man was absolutely torn into shreds. He wanted to torture that damned girl, throw her into jail, leave her in the forest to the wolves and then throw her off a cliff.

"Someone!"

"Here! What does Duke need?"

Chu Moran appeared at the doorway but Chu Beijie had suddenly calmed down again.

No, he couldn't let her die so easily. That girl should stay in his residence for her whole lifetime, to repent for her crimes. He'd sometimes go to tease her, and make her cry.

The next day, Pingting got sick, just when Chu Beijie had planned to taunt her.

"Sick?" Chu Beijie's eyes flickered towards Chu Moran and he coldly laughed, "Is this another one of her deceptions, 'soldiers know fraud'?"

"The doctor has already seen her. She is seriously sick." Chu Moran replied, his voice grave.

Chu Beijie's eyes flashed, "What does she have?"

"Long-term symptoms, continuous coughing and drowsiness."

Chu Beijie thought of that night when Pingting had also been sick, and he had personally carried her into her room. He remembered those energetic eyes slowly close and how under the moonlight, he had truly thought she was a real beauty.

"Duke...are you going to see her?"

A sharp gaze turned to Chu Moran, forcing him to take a step back. He lowered his head and hurriedly said, "I-I-I just thought...maybe..."

Chu Beijie looked away and sat back at the desk, grabbed an official document and carefully read it. Then in a hesitant voice, he asked "Which doctor did you hire?"

"Chen Guanzhi."

"She's just a maid, no need to provide her a famous doctor."

Chu Moran had hardly ever been criticised by his Master and he paled, "Okay, I'll change it immediately..."

"No need," Chu Beijie picked up a pen, flamboyantly wrote two lines of approval on the document. He seemed to have calmed down a little, "He's already been hired, so don't bother anymore."

"Yes."

"Is she taking her medicine?"

"We've already bought the items on Chen Guanzhi's prescription and it's currently being boiled."

Chu Beijie scowled, "She rebelled against me and yet she still gets a famous doctor and boiled medicine. Nice timing to get sick. Unfortunately for her, I'm a warrior from the blood-stained deserts, not a naive boy from flowery plains. When she gets better, tell her to stop playing her games in my residence."

Chu Moran could sense his master's wrath and he remained as quiet as possible, nodding, "Yes."

He was about to leave when Chu Beijie looked up from his documents again, as if he had another thought. "The King gave me two boxes of Yumei Tianxiang pills. Since we don't have any high-ranking females in this residence, I thought they'd go to waste. Now that we have an ailed woman here, we can give those to her."
